The feminist artists from the late 1960s and early 1970s regarded the American connection with food regarding the constraints it placed on Women of all ages. Feminists asserted that the private—including the most mundane elements of everyday life—was political. In 1972, Miriam Schapiro and Judy Chicago rented a vacant 17-area household in L. a. which was scheduled for demolition and turned it into a massive art set up. Schapiro together with other female artists developed an immersive installation from the dining area, mimicking the procedure women comply with when decorating dollhouses.
